Interpretation

What this quote means

The quote expresses the overwhelming feeling of love, comparing it to the powerful and chaotic nature of a hurricane.

In this quote, Neil Young uses the metaphor of a hurricane to illustrate the emotional whirlwind that love can create. The calmness in the eyes of the beloved amidst the chaos signifies a deep connection and tranquility that the speaker finds in their partner, while simultaneously feeling overwhelmed by the intensity of their feelings.
